This week, Kate Molleson follows Felix Mendelssohn's journeys across the British Isles. Today, a summer tour takes the young composer north to Scotland, where dramatic landscapes, Highland culture and the Hebrides leave an indelible (though not always positive) mark on his imagination. Along the way, he finds inspiration for some of his best-loved music, including the Scottish Symphony and Hebrides Overture. But not every destination proves equally enchanting, as a rain-soaked stay in Wales leaves Mendelssohn with rather different impressions. Symphony No. 3 in A minor, Op. 56, Scottish: II.
